Overview

Digital and Analytics offers innovative solutions that provide actionable insights to internal and external business partners and customers that help reduce health costs, improve outcomes, provide financial security and measure/forecast business performance. Advanced Supply Analytics & Design drives the vision and delivery of solutions to maximize healthcare affordability through the provider profiling and network products for steerage to high performing providers. This role will lead advanced analytics focused on the identification of higher performing providers to enable steerage, geo-access, network adequacy & design of competitively affordable network products. Additionally, this role will collaborate on advanced analytics roadmap including working with the Data Science Center of Expertise to progress technical and methodological capabilities using the Analytics Platform. This role will provide insights, influence business strategy, and execute in partnership with stakeholders, product management and IT via agile delivery teams.
